1. Leaky Faucets and Pipes
One of the most frequent plumbing problems homeowners face is leaking faucets or pipes. These leaks may seem minor at first, but over time they can waste a significant amount of water and lead to higher utility bills. Leak detection is a crucial part of plumbing repairs because hidden leaks inside walls or under floors can cause structural damage and mold growth if ignored. 2. Clogged Drains and Slow Draining Sinks
Clogged drains are another common headache for homeowners. Whether it’s the kitchen sink, bathroom drain, or shower, slow or backed-up drains can make daily routines frustrating. Hair, soap scum, grease, and food particles often accumulate inside pipes, leading to blockages. Regular drain cleaning is essential to prevent these clogs from turning into bigger issues. 3. Water Heater Problems
A malfunctioning water heater can disrupt your comfort, especially during colder months. Common water heater issues include inconsistent water temperature, leaks around the tank, or strange noises coming from the unit. 4. Running Toilets
A running toilet is more than just an annoyance—it wastes hundreds of gallons of water daily if left unaddressed. The problem usually stems from worn-out flapper valves or faulty fill valves inside the toilet tank. 5. Low Water Pressure
Low water pressure can affect showers, faucets, and appliances, making everyday tasks less efficient. Causes range from sediment buildup in pipes to leaks or issues with the municipal water supply.
